Common Name2-OXOTHIOLANE
ClassSmall Molecule
DescriptionDihydro-2(3H)-thiophenone is found in coffee and coffee products. Dihydro-2(3H)-thiophenone is a component of roasted coffee bean

Chemical Taxonomy
Description belongs to the class of organic compounds known as thiolanes. These are organic compounds containing thiolane, a five-member saturated ring containing four carbon atoms and a sulfur atom.
